Ferring Street Veterinary Surgery describes itself as a family-run practice. Based on its website, it’s set up for routine care plus a fairly broad in-house diagnostics and surgery work-up, including digital radiography (X‑ray), ultrasound, ECG, in-house blood testing, dentistry, and soft-tissue surgery (with laparoscopic surgery and endoscopy also listed). It also offers 24/7 digital vet support via the VidiVet app. In the latest reviews available to us, owners most often highlight being seen at short notice, clear explanations of treatment/medication (and costs when asked), and the ability to see the same vet consistently.

Arun Veterinary Group is an independent veterinary practice established in 1972. Based on its website and recent reviews, it appears set up not just for routine care but also for more complex cases, with a dual accredited hospital and emergency status and out-of-hours hospitalisation listed. Owners describe coming here for a second opinion where a cruciate ligament rupture was identified quickly after another vet had suggested arthritis; X‑rays were used to confirm the diagnosis and the repair surgery was carried out successfully at another branch within the group. One reviewer also notes a practical admin process for claims, mentioning a dedicated email to help ensure insurance paperwork goes through.

Crossways Animal Care Ltd is a small-animal veterinary practice (ownership/group not stated in the available information). Based on the latest reviews, it appears set up for routine veterinary care for dogs, with multiple owners emphasising the clinic’s advice and how they were treated during visits. Specific points mentioned include: “accurate and thoughtful advice” for dogs over several years, patience and kindness from both vets and reception staff, and owners feeling the team genuinely cares about their pets. There is also a single 1‑star review with no written detail, which sits alongside otherwise strongly positive feedback.
